1st Case of Avian Influenza found in PA
Madison Kwiecinski News Editor Mvk5945@psu.edu The first case of a new strain of Avian Influenza was found in a deceased Bald Eagle in Pennsylvania. The Pennsylvania Game Commission announced a dead bald eagle had tested positive for the highly contagious pathogenic avian influenza, otherwise known as HPAI H5N1. The bird was found outside of Philadelphia. …

PA School Plans to Limit Students Bringing Food
A local Pennsylvania school district plans to search school lunches and limit students’ snack and drink consumption during the school day. Aliquippa School District announced this new policy on Facebook, garnering hundreds of angry comments from parents and leading to the post being quickly deleted the next morning.
